View Issue Details

IDProjectCategoryView StatusLast Update
0026537Open CASCADEOCCT:Documentationpublic2016-04-20 15:48
Reporterbugmaster Assigned Toski 
PrioritynormalSeverityminor 
Status closedResolutionfixed 
Target Version7.0.0Fixed in Version7.0.0 
Summary0026537: It is not possible to generate reference documentation in new structure of OCCT
Description1. Overview - OK
2. PDF - OK
3. CHM - OK
3. RD - can be generated if only installed includes copied to OCCT root

The same is actual for products.


Steps To Reproducegendoc.bat -refman
TagsNo tags attached.
Test case numberNot needed

Activities

git

2015-08-10 14:52

administrator   ~0043940

Branch CR26537 has been created by ibs.

SHA-1: b8408701cdd40c34c3e85b7fb5394cb0f8091ab0


Detailed log of new commits:

Author: ibs
Date: Mon Aug 10 14:50:34 2015 +0300

    0026537: It is not possible to generate reference documentation in new structure of OCCT
    
    the path to search required headers changed from <occt>/inc to <occt>/src/<each package>

ibs

2015-08-10 14:53

developer   ~0043941

dear bugmaster,

a fix has been integrated into CR26537 branch of OCCT git, please try to generate refman once again

ibs

2015-08-10 15:07

developer   ~0043943

dear apn,
could you apply the fix to the OCCT products

bugmaster

2015-08-10 15:31

administrator   ~0043946

Reference documentation is generated correctly.

git

2015-08-11 12:23

administrator   ~0043966

Branch CR26537 has been updated by apn.

SHA-1: 7cd89b7d1162306f291cd665032db23179e544d0


Detailed log of new commits:

Author: apn
Date: Tue Aug 11 12:23:32 2015 +0300

    Fix for OCCT products reference documentation

apn

2015-08-11 12:34

administrator   ~0043967

Products reference documentation is generated from occt gendoc.bat. It's necessary to define variable PRODROOT in env.bat (if variable isn't defined documentation will be generated for occt).
Option -m contains list of modules (-m=ACIS,EMesh,SSP,SAT). If this option is missing, documentation will be generated for all modules.

Dear abv, could you please review.

abv

2015-08-12 09:27

manager   ~0044008

Reviewed, please integrate.

One question, however: do we use the same script for generation of reference manual for products?

apn

2015-08-12 12:15

administrator   ~0044028

Yes, if PRODROOT isn't empty, documentation will be generated for products.

git

2015-08-14 10:51

administrator   ~0044114

Branch CR26537 has been deleted by inv.

SHA-1: 7cd89b7d1162306f291cd665032db23179e544d0

Related Changesets

occt: master a9d2efda

2015-08-13 08:19:10

ibs


Committer: ski Details Diff
0026537: It is not possible to generate reference documentation in new structure of OCCT

the path to search required headers changed from <occt>/inc to <occt>/src/<each package>

Fix for OCCT products reference documentation
Affected Issues
0026537
mod - adm/gendoc.tcl Diff File
mod - adm/occaux.tcl Diff File
mod - adm/templates/env.bat.in Diff File
mod - adm/templates/env.build.bat.in Diff File

Issue History

Date Modified Username Field Change
2015-08-10 13:15 bugmaster New Issue
2015-08-10 13:15 bugmaster Assigned To => ysn
2015-08-10 13:15 bugmaster Assigned To ysn => ibs
2015-08-10 14:36 bugmaster Description Updated
2015-08-10 14:51 ibs Status new => resolved
2015-08-10 14:51 ibs Steps to Reproduce Updated
2015-08-10 14:52 git Note Added: 0043940
2015-08-10 14:53 ibs Note Added: 0043941
2015-08-10 14:53 ibs Assigned To ibs => bugmaster
2015-08-10 14:53 ibs Status resolved => reviewed
2015-08-10 15:07 ibs Note Added: 0043943
2015-08-10 15:07 ibs Assigned To bugmaster => apn
2015-08-10 15:07 ibs Status reviewed => assigned
2015-08-10 15:31 bugmaster Note Added: 0043946
2015-08-10 15:31 bugmaster Status assigned => tested
2015-08-11 12:23 git Note Added: 0043966
2015-08-11 12:34 apn Note Added: 0043967
2015-08-11 12:34 apn Test case number => Not needed
2015-08-11 12:34 apn Assigned To apn => abv
2015-08-11 12:34 apn Status tested => assigned
2015-08-11 12:34 apn Status assigned => resolved
2015-08-12 09:27 abv Note Added: 0044008
2015-08-12 09:27 abv Assigned To abv => bugmaster
2015-08-12 09:27 abv Status resolved => reviewed
2015-08-12 12:15 apn Note Added: 0044028
2015-08-13 10:18 bugmaster Status reviewed => tested
2015-08-14 10:26 ski Changeset attached => occt master a9d2efda
2015-08-14 10:26 ski Assigned To bugmaster => ski
2015-08-14 10:26 ski Status tested => verified
2015-08-14 10:26 ski Resolution open => fixed
2015-08-14 10:51 git Note Added: 0044114
2016-04-20 15:44 aiv Fixed in Version => 7.0.0
2016-04-20 15:48 aiv Status verified => closed